Man, 72, killed in Marysville collision with semitruck

A 72-year-old man was killed in a Marysville collision Wednesday afternoon.

The Lake Stevens man was in the passenger seat of a 2006 Toyota Avalon when the driver lost control of the vehicle around 12:44 p.m. on Highway 9 near 84th Street Northeast. The Avalon went into the northbound lane and was hit by a semitruck.

The driver of the Avalon was also injured and taken to Providence Regional Medical Center Everett.

Trooper Kelsey Harding, a state patrol spokesperson, said that the rainy weather was a contributing factor and that the crash was accidental.

The driver of the semi was uninjured.
